Burnett County (KRZN) in Siren, Wisconsin has 2 asphalt runways. The longest is Runway 14/32 at 5,000 ft by 75 ft. Runway 05/23 is 3,900 ft by 75 ft. No ILS runway ends are published for KRZN. The field elevation is 989.3 ft MSL. This is an uncontrolled field with no control tower.

For runway alignment, 05/23 is oriented 045°/225° magnetic. Runway 14/32 is oriented 137°/317° magnetic. No LAHSO notes are published. No runway-specific noise abatement notes are published. Pilots should use the current FAA Chart Supplement for the latest published airport data before flight.

Traffic pattern

Pattern altitude is not published. Use standard 1,000 ft AGL for light piston aircraft unless local procedure or ATC says otherwise. KRZN has no control tower, so pilots self-announce and self-sequence in the pattern. Runway 05/23 and Runway 14/32 are the published runway options. No right-traffic exceptions are published. No runway-specific pattern notes are published in the facts. Keep the pattern tight and stay alert for other traffic on CTAF.
